    Abstract: PURPOSE: A rotary anodic oxidation device and a method thereof are provided to form a nanostructure in a short time using high voltages as metal material is circulated enough to offset an exothermic reaction generated by an oxidation reaction under a condition of high voltages through rotation. CONSTITUTION: A rotary anodic oxidation device comprises an object(110), a counter electrode(120), a power supply unit(130), a water tank(140), a cooling unit, a rotating unit(160). The object is positioned in a positive electrode. The counter electrode is positioned in a negative electrode. The power supply unit applies a constant voltage between the positive and negative electrodes. Electrolyte solution is filled in the water tank. Metal and the counter electrode are dipped into the electrolyte solution. The cooling unit makes a cooling medium circulate to the outside of the water tank for controlling the temperature of the electrolyte solution. The rotating unit rotates a workpiece.
